2  Alternate cryptocurrencies / Altcoin Discussion / cgminer 2.11.4 and LTC on: April 17, 2013, 06:48:48 AM
I seems to have some problem and I will appreciate some help. I have 2 ATi7950 running and no issues whatsoever when I mine BTC, getting from 480-550 Mh/s depend on how I set them in catalyst control center.
My pool went down for a while so I tried to mine some LTC but that is something I do not understand well, it seems I cant set it run properly. In cgminer window it looks both run in approx same speed in range of 500 Kh/s yet when I check pool website with stats it show me I am on something like 80-100 Kh/s when it should be like approx 1000 Kh/s.
I used cgminer 2.11.4 and cgeasy.jar to create .bat file
Can anyone who knows how-to look at pictures and suggest what may be wrong? Or suggest what to use for LTC?
I tested it at notroll and litecoinpool but very slow speed on first one and getting only rejects on second one.
